Excerpt from Commentary on the Epistle to the Hebrews, Vol. 2

The five attributes which follow are not a mere expansion of the Taioi''rros (schlichting); nor, on the other hand, are they indefinite additions to its meaning (lunemann, Bleck, De Wette, etc.) but are selected to characterize Him who is both a priest after the order of Melchizedek, and (beyond the type of Melchizedek) a high priest, the antitype of Aaron.
